Why Did Twitter Want Tesla CEO Elon Musk On Its Board?

Elon Musk isn’t joining the Twitter Board. The Tesla CEO was slated to join the micro-blogging site on 9 April Saturday but he informed Twitter the same morning that he won’t join, said Twitter CEO Parag Agrawal.

Why Was Twitter Bringing Elon Musk To Its Board?

Twitter Want Tesla CEO Elon Musk On Its Board

According to the company it considered Elon Musk as a fiduciary of the company and expected him to add value to it with his ideas of radical change. Twitter CEO Parag Agrawal formally informed its shareholders about Elon Musk joining the board on April 5 but the Tesla CEO decided not to join the board and remain a shareholder. It is to be noted that Elon Musk is the biggest shareholder in Twitter.

After the Elon Musk incident, Twitter CEO Parag Agrawal said that there would be distractions ahead but their goals and priorities remained unchanged. Parag Agrawal further maintained that the decisions they make and how they execute them were in their hands, no one else’s. He called his team to tune out the noise and stay focused on the work.

What Were The Ideas Of Radical Changes Promoted By Elon Musk?

Elon Musk started a poll for turning the San Francisco headquarters of Twitter into a shelter for the homeless. He also suggested a ban on Twitter ads as it could give big corporations the power to dictate terms. Parag Agrawal welcomed his decision not to join the board saying that was for the best.
